DHCP сервер

Материал из ALT Linux Wiki
Примечание: Обратите внимение, что это не официальная документация, а попытка начинающего админа объяснить материал начинающим админам.

DHCP сервер - сервер присваивающий по одноименному протоколу IP-адреса и другие параметры TCP/IP необходимые для работы устройств в сети.

Установка

# apt-get install dhcp-server

Настройка

1. Настройте статический IP-адрес
2. Настройте DHCP-сервер

# mcedit /etc/dhcp/dhcpd.conf
ddns-update-style none;

subnet 10.0.0.0 netmask 255.255.255.0 { #сеть и маска подсети
        option routers                  10.0.0.1; #адрес маршрутизатора
        option subnet-mask              255.255.255.0; #маска подсети

        option nis-domain               "domain.org"; #NIS-домен
        option domain-name              "domain.org"; #домен
        option domain-name-servers      195.54.2.1; #DNS-сервера для клиентов

        range dynamic-bootp 10.0.0.128 10.0.0.250; #диапазон DHCP-подсети

        #ручное резервирование адресов
        host boss 
        {
        hardware ethernet 00:1C:C0:45:27:14;
        fixed-address 10.0.0.2;
        }

        host pavel
        {
        hardware ethernet 00:1C:C0:45:28:2B;
        fixed-address 10.0.0.3;
        }

        #стандартное и максимальное время аренды (в секундах)
        #6 часов
        default-lease-time 21600;
        #12 часов
        max-lease-time 43200;
}

Укажите сетевой интерефейс, через который будет работать DHCP-сервер

# mcedit /etc/sysconfig/dhcpd
DHCPDARGS=eth0

3.Для того чтобы DHCP-сервер автоматически запускался

# chkconfig dhcpd on
# service dhcpd start